How to fill out epayroll and batch payment:

01
Login to your online banking account and navigate to the payroll or payments section.
02
Select "epayroll" or "batch payment" option.
03
Fill in the required information for each employee or payment recipient, such as their full name, account number, and payment amount.
04
Review the details entered to ensure accuracy.
05
If necessary, add any additional notes or instructions for specific payments.
06
Select the date you want the payments to be processed.
07
Double-check all the details and click on the "Submit" or "Confirm" button to initiate the payment process.
08
Once the payments are successfully submitted, you will likely receive a confirmation message or reference number.

Who needs epayroll and batch payment:

01
Individuals or businesses that regularly process payroll for their employees can benefit from using epayroll. It simplifies the payroll process, eliminates the need for physical checks, and allows for direct deposit into employees' bank accounts.
02
Companies that frequently make multiple payments to different vendors or suppliers can benefit from using batch payment. It streamlines the payment process, reduces manual processing time, and ensures timely payment to multiple recipients.
03
Any organization or individual looking for a more efficient and convenient way to manage payments electronically can consider using epayroll and batch payment services.
